Chelsea Hedrick

Chelsea Hedrick coordinates health and wellness programs serving children and adults with Down syndrome, including the Dare to Play Football Camp with Ed McCaffrey, Global’s Denver Broncos Cheerleaders Dare to Cheer Camp, the Dare to Play Soccer Camp with Regis University and the Colorado Rapids, the Be Beautiful Be Yourself Dance Class with the Colorado Ballet, and the Global Down Syndrome Educational Series. In addition to these programs Chelsea assists in vetting and launching new programs at Global. 

Before joining Global, Hedrick worked for Kroenke Sports & Entertainment, where she managed the grassroots marketing and community relations initiatives for the Colorado Rapids. In May of 2011, Hedrick earned her bachelor’s degree in Sport and Entertainment Management from the University of South Carolina.

Chelsea is a Colorado native and currently resides in Denver. In her spare time, she enjoys hiking, snowboarding, attending sporting events and concerts, and spending time with her family at their cabin the mountains.
